Output 52d5980f502ba1bd6dd9f3f197950c84d0ebd6fa363dddef89e72fa2085dc9f9:24

value
104642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db02d7baf5995270275a819154acbad6b1a4c33f OP_EQUAL
address
3Mf3K4w8kA8mLWHPpYbGJZxGASKTMojM1j
transaction
52d5980f502ba1bd6dd9f3f197950c84d0ebd6fa363dddef89e72fa2085dc9f9